Output 33576a7e8bb75f2349c305557bef5b64e7382ddaf0aa494964a36b645f60c92b:0

value
21212012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2edc1001c5baba69de264e5286e31cc06fa8522c OP_EQUAL
address
MCAvwU2eC1gcF4fT5z7hyM1r2f7aXWK36K
transaction
33576a7e8bb75f2349c305557bef5b64e7382ddaf0aa494964a36b645f60c92b
spent
true